City Style bringing out St. Louis’ fashionable men

  • Email this
  • Print this

kev2.jpgIf I’d known wearing short-short ties and True Religion jeans would get me a full-page display in a certain St. Louis glossy mag, I might have given up both months ago.

The modeling game is not for me.

Alive magazine chose me as one of the city’s best-dressed males and put me in its current men’s issue (I know it’s crazy, but thanks!)

This is something I would’ve never imagined in my 21 years working as a journalist, mostly spent as a music critic.

The shoot took place during an especially hot day a few months ago in a downtown loft. I was decked out in Marc Ekco and Affliction clothing chosen by Alive’s Jill Manoff. Kudos to her for nicely picking fashions based on my own personal style, and to photographer Tuan Lee for that keeper of a photo.

Though on one hand it was cool having a stylist and makeup person fuss over me, it was also unnerving, especially in the studio where about a dozen staffers were present, with all eyes on me.

I know my role, and this definitely wasn’t it. I much prefer staying in my lane, but am grateful for this out-of-the-box experience.

Other men chosen for the issue were Arnold Donald, Brad Boyes, Chris Long, Jacob Laws, Mike Bush, and Nicholae Bica.

City Style: A Men’s Event, the accompanying party for the issue (of course there would be a party) is at 9 p.m. Saturday at the Sky Terrace at the Four Seasons, and will feature a Macy’s men’s fashion show and a Solique women’s lingerie show.

A $10 suggested donation benefits Food Outreach.
